In this second edition of her acclaimed volume, The Women of Colonial Latin America, Susan Migden Socolow has revised substantial portions of the book - incorporating new topics and illustrative cases that significantly expand topics addressed in the first edition; updating historiography; and adding new material on poor, rural, indigenous and slave women.

Männlichkeit und Weiblichkeit - auch im antiken Griechenland bestimmten diese Kategorien das alltägliche Leben und die jeweilige Position im gesellschaftlichen Gefüge. Verschiedene Geschlechterbilder aus Mythos, Philosophie und Medizin prägten die griechische Kultur. Welche faktischen Auswirkungen hatten diese Stereotypen auf das Leben griechischer Frauen und Männer? Welche Anforderungen stellte man im antiken Griechenland an positive Weiblichkeit und Männlichkeit und auf welche Weise wurden diese durchgesetzt? Wie wurde man in Griechenland zum Mann und zur Frau gemacht und in welcher Beziehung standen die Geschlechter in den einzelnen Feldern der sozialen Praxis zueinander? Tanja Scheer nimmt die Geschlechterverhältnisse in verschiedenen Bereichen des antiken Lebens in den Blick und stellt wichtige Forschungskontroversen vor. Sie bezieht sexuelle und Gefühlsbeziehungen ebenso mit ein wie die Verteilung von Autorität und Aufgaben im antiken Haushalt, in Krieg und Frieden sowie in der antiken "Öffentlichkeit" von Religion und Politik. Das Ergebnis ist ein gut geschriebenes, zugleich forschungsnahes und problemorientiertes Studienbuch.

Women without Men illuminates Russia's "quiet revolution" in family life through the lens of single motherhood. Drawing on extensive ethnographic and interview data, Jennifer Utrata focuses on the puzzle of how single motherhood-frequently seen as a social problem in other contexts-became taken for granted in the New Russia. While most Russians, including single mothers, believe that two-parent families are preferable, many also contend that single motherhood is an inevitable by-product of two intractable problems: "weak men" (reflected, they argue, in the country's widespread, chronic male alcoholism) and a "weak state" (considered so because of Russia's unequal economy and poor social services). Among the daily struggles to get by and get ahead, single motherhood, Utrata finds, is seldom considered a tragedy. Utrata begins by tracing the history of the cultural category of "single mother," from the state policies that created this category after World War II, through the demographic trends that contributed to rising rates of single motherhood, to the contemporary tension between the cultural ideal of the two-parent family and the de facto predominance of the matrifocal family. Providing a vivid narrative of the experiences not only of single mothers themselves but also of the grandmothers, other family members, and nonresident fathers who play roles in their lives, Women without Men maps the Russian family against the country's profound postwar social disruptions and dislocations.

Questions that concern gender and violence against women have been placed firmly on the agenda of interdisciplinary research within the humanities in recent years. Gender-based violence against women has increased exponentially in South Africa and in other countries on the African continent, particularly those with a history of political conflict. Researchers who explore such gender issues have paid limited attention to the intersection between the social contexts of the researched, the positionality of the researcher and the research product. This book brings together an interdisciplinary group of scholars and scholar-activists to explore new terrains of knowledge production, interrogating the connection between the intellectual project of this kind of research and the process of its production. Some chapters draw on theoretical insights and provide new ways of thinking about the kinds of questions that should be asked when conducting research in the field of gender. Other authors grapple with an acknowledgement of their multiple social positions in the world, the ways in which they experience these ever-shifting boundaries, and how this influences their theoretical and practical work. Some contributions go further, discussing the ways in which the researcher and the researched influence each other, and the link between feminist research and social change. These chapters contribute to an understanding of how social movement activism can be developed. Overall, this book represents an important combination of scholarly insights, and provides multiple reflections about practical aspects of conducting gender research in the African context. The work of the contributors to the volume is situated within a post-structural feminist agenda, and, collectively, the chapters link scholarship and activism in a way that pursues a social change agenda in research on gender and gender-based violence.

The book is in essence made up of multiple threads. In the first place we introduce a discussion on the concept of gender, which is essential as a category of analysis in the social sciences. Later come considerations focused around women's and men's professional, political and social situation, business, time use, activity in the R&D and patent sector. These profiles have ultimately been used to determine the scope of the category Innovative Gender, by which, as it is assumed, we can capture the role of gender in the innovation process.
